Meeting notes, FeedProbe sync (excerpt). Discussed the podcast feed validator's handling of malformed enclosure tags. Agreed to reject feeds with duplicate GUIDs rather than silently deduplicating, since downstream caching at Larkmont depends on uniqueness. Reviewer should check the new XML namespace fallback logic carefully — it touches the legacy parser path. Test fixtures were regenerated; expect a large diff. Merge is blocked until sign-off from the component owner:

named custodian: Brivan Eliath Quenox Frador

Subject: Incremental rebuilds now live

As of today, the Fernpress build pipeline performs incremental static rebuilds by default. Plugin hooks that assumed full rebuilds should declare their dependencies explicitly, or output may go stale. Full-rebuild mode remains available per project. The rebuild service now runs with the configuration that follows.

settings of fafog-haduf:
ZORIX_PIN=4648
ZORIX_METRICS_HOST=metrics.zorix.paliqsys.corp
ZORIX_LOG_LEVEL=info
ZORIX_TENANT=druix

## Build Provenance — LiftwaveSim

Every LiftwaveSim build is produced by the Hoistline pipeline, which records the compiler version, dependency lockfile hash, and the exact dispatch-model parameters baked into the binary. New team members should verify provenance before sharing any simulator artifact, since unverified builds have caused mismatched elevator-queue results in past reviews. The pipeline stamps each artifact with a token you can check below.

trace token, fafog-kageg: htk4_98e6